I wanted to know what people thought about their gaming experiences.
 
I went with a nvidia gtx 780 after running ati cards for well over a decade. Part of that choice was down to curiosity and the other part was simply down to the horrendous idle power consumption on the ati cards when running multi monitors. So far it's been a very smooth transition from my old HD6970 as i've not had any issues to deal with. The only drawback's for me with anything from nvidia is that things like g-sync and 3d you have to pay extra for where it was free with ati. For example, i ran 3d to my panasonic plasma via the 6970 in a few games without any problem, but now i can't do it without paying for the 3dtv software add on. It's even more irritating when you've paid more for the card than the equivalent ati card. I'm glad that i don't care much for 3d or g-sync. PhysX is nice too, but not something i'd pay extra just to have.

GTX780. Find one that is already factory clocked to 1Ghz+ (GA Ghz, PNY XLR8, Zotac AMP, etc), comes with 3 fans cooling solution and try to buy for less than £380.

I bought a PNY XLR8 OC end of November and haven't looked back. Superb card, runs everything maxed out on 1080p, and can play games that support Vision 3d also. As for Physx, the games are so few (around 55 since 2007) that isn't the "buying" factor for me, neither is the G-Sync, or the other crap.

Btw upgraded from 2 7950s and I run the 780 at factory overclocks 24/7. Nothing has beaten it yet to ramp it up to 1297 overclock that can achieve with the factory BIOS.


But you cannot go wrong with a R9 290 factory overclocked at 1000+ either, especially if your CPU isn't an i5/i7 but an AMD one, so you can benefit from Mantle.
